Lillo Brancato Jr. (born August 30, 1976) is an American actor. He is best known for his portrayal of Calogero “C” Anello in Robert De Niro's 1993 directorial debut, A Bronx Tale. He also portrayed Matthew Bevilaqua, a young aspiring mobster, on The Sopranos.

Lillo Brancato is a Colombian-born actor and producer, known for A Bronx Tale, Crimson Tide and Renaissance Man. He was convicted of attempted burglary and served 10 years in prison for the death of an off-duty police officer in 2005.
Apr 28, 2024 · Lillo Brancato was convicted for his role in the fatal shooting of NYPD Officer Daniel Enchautegui in 2005. He is now sober and helps others struggling with addiction at a recovery center in New Jersey.
